@theKwekster I highly recommend taking two summer sessions (one before the first Fall semester), if you’re committed to transferring in two years. That way, you can have a slightly more lenient schedule. Also, for your first semester, I recommend just taking the first 3 courses if possible - those 3 courses alone will be difficult for an incoming HS student.

Many engineering transfers take 3 years in CC to maintain a high GPA. You can be seriously burnt out if you try to cram everything into two - but it can be done.
